Transaction 33dd26fe3320802cfbfd56d12a63cda94d89ff9b2c9e0e72d53f5d8e3f12a63a
1 Input
1 Output
-
33dd26fe3320802cfbfd56d12a63cda94d89ff9b2c9e0e72d53f5d8e3f12a63a:0
- value
- 1016922
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 088385d7fc68bba819be3522f003863ff24a3d4b OP_EQUAL
- address
- 32U2tSjx8zJCZQ3xLXKMViqRWkwEBV1SQk